Approximately how much of our Sun's incoming energy is reflected back to the into space​

Answer:

30% is reflected into space

Step-by-step explanation:

Earth's average albedo is about 0.3. In other words, about 30 percent of incoming solar radiation is reflected back into space and 70 percent is absorbed. A sensor aboard NASA's Terra satellite is now collecting detailed measurements of how much sunlight the earth's surface reflects back up into the atmosphere.
